- namespace Doctrine\ORM\Persisters;
- use Doctrine\ORM\PersistentCollection;
- use Doctrine\ORM\UnitOfWork;
- /**
- * Persister for one-to-many collections.
- *
- * @author Roman Borschel <roman@code-factory.org>
- * @author Guilherme Blanco <guilhermeblanco@hotmail.com>
- * @author Alexander <iam.asm89@gmail.com>
- * @since 2.0
- */
- class OneToManyPersister extends AbstractCollectionPersister
- {
- /**
- * {@inheritdoc}
- *
- * @override
- */
- public function get(PersistentCollection $coll, $index)
- {
- $mapping = $coll->getMapping();
- $uow = $this->em->getUnitOfWork();
- $persister = $uow->getEntityPersister($mapping['targetEntity']);
- if (!isset($mapping['indexBy'])) {
- throw new \BadMethodCallException("Selecting a collection by index is only supported on indexed collections.");
- }
- return $persister->load(array($mapping['mappedBy'] => $coll->getOwner(), $mapping['indexBy'] => $index), null, null, array(), 0, 1);
- }
- /**
- * Generates the SQL UPDATE that updates a particular row's foreign
- * key to null.
- *
- * @param \Doctrine\ORM\PersistentCollection $coll
- *
- * @return string
- *
- * @override
- */
- protected function getDeleteRowSQL(PersistentCollection $coll)
- {
- $mapping = $coll->getMapping();
- $class = $this->em->getClassMetadata($mapping['targetEntity']);
- $tableName = $this->quoteStrategy->getTableName($class, $this->platform);
- $idColumns = $class->getIdentifierColumnNames();
- return 'DELETE FROM ' . $tableName
- . ' WHERE ' . implode('= ? AND ', $idColumns) . ' = ?';
- }
- /**
- * {@inheritdoc}
- */
- protected function getDeleteRowSQLParameters(PersistentCollection $coll, $element)
- {
- return array_values($this->uow->getEntityIdentifier($element));
- }
- /**
- * {@inheritdoc}
- *
- * @throws \BadMethodCallException Not used for OneToManyPersister.
- */
- protected function getInsertRowSQL(PersistentCollection $coll)
- {
- throw new \BadMethodCallException("Insert Row SQL is not used for OneToManyPersister");
- }
- /**
- * {@inheritdoc}
- *
- * @throws \BadMethodCallException Not used for OneToManyPersister.
- */
- protected function getInsertRowSQLParameters(PersistentCollection $coll, $element)
- {
- throw new \BadMethodCallException("Insert Row SQL is not used for OneToManyPersister");
- }
- /**
- * {@inheritdoc}
- *
- * @throws \BadMethodCallException Not used for OneToManyPersister.
- */
- protected function getUpdateRowSQL(PersistentCollection $coll)
- {
- throw new \BadMethodCallException("Update Row SQL is not used for OneToManyPersister");
- }
- /**
- * {@inheritdoc}
- *
- * @throws \BadMethodCallException Not used for OneToManyPersister.
- */
- protected function getDeleteSQL(PersistentCollection $coll)
- {
- throw new \BadMethodCallException("Update Row SQL is not used for OneToManyPersister");
- }
- /**
- * {@inheritdoc}
- *
- * @throws \BadMethodCallException Not used for OneToManyPersister.
- */
- protected function getDeleteSQLParameters(PersistentCollection $coll)
- {
- throw new \BadMethodCallException("Update Row SQL is not used for OneToManyPersister");
- }
- /**
- * {@inheritdoc}
- */
- public function count(PersistentCollection $coll)
- {
- $mapping = $coll->getMapping();
- $targetClass = $this->em->getClassMetadata($mapping['targetEntity']);
- $sourceClass = $this->em->getClassMetadata($mapping['sourceEntity']);
- $id = $this->em->getUnitOfWork()->getEntityIdentifier($coll->getOwner());
- $whereClauses = array();
- $params = array();
- $joinColumns = $targetClass->associationMappings[$mapping['mappedBy']]['joinColumns'];
- foreach ($joinColumns as $joinColumn) {
- $whereClauses[] = $joinColumn['name'] . ' = ?';
- $params[] = ($targetClass->containsForeignIdentifier)
- ? $id[$sourceClass->getFieldForColumn($joinColumn['referencedColumnName'])]
- : $id[$sourceClass->fieldNames[$joinColumn['referencedColumnName']]];
- }
- $filterTargetClass = $this->em->getClassMetadata($targetClass->rootEntityName);
- foreach ($this->em->getFilters()->getEnabledFilters() as $filter) {
- if ($filterExpr = $filter->addFilterConstraint($filterTargetClass, 't')) {
- $whereClauses[] = '(' . $filterExpr . ')';
- }
- }
- $sql = 'SELECT count(*)'
- . ' FROM ' . $this->quoteStrategy->getTableName($targetClass, $this->platform) . ' t'
- . ' WHERE ' . implode(' AND ', $whereClauses);
- return $this->conn->fetchColumn($sql, $params);
- }
- /**
- * @param \Doctrine\ORM\PersistentCollection $coll
- * @param int $offset
- * @param int|null $length
- *
- * @return \Doctrine\Common\Collections\ArrayCollection
- */
- public function slice(PersistentCollection $coll, $offset, $length = null)
- {
- $mapping = $coll->getMapping();
- $uow = $this->em->getUnitOfWork();
- $persister = $uow->getEntityPersister($mapping['targetEntity']);
- return $persister->getOneToManyCollection($mapping, $coll->getOwner(), $offset, $length);
- }
- /**
- * @param \Doctrine\ORM\PersistentCollection $coll
- * @param object $element
- *
- * @return boolean
- */
- public function contains(PersistentCollection $coll, $element)
- {
- $mapping = $coll->getMapping();
- $uow = $this->em->getUnitOfWork();
- // shortcut for new entities
- $entityState = $uow->getEntityState($element, UnitOfWork::STATE_NEW);
- if ($entityState === UnitOfWork::STATE_NEW) {
- return false;
- }
- // Entity is scheduled for inclusion
- if ($entityState === UnitOfWork::STATE_MANAGED && $uow->isScheduledForInsert($element)) {
- return false;
- }
- $persister = $uow->getEntityPersister($mapping['targetEntity']);
- // only works with single id identifier entities. Will throw an
- // exception in Entity Persisters if that is not the case for the
- // 'mappedBy' field.
- $id = current( $uow->getEntityIdentifier($coll->getOwner()));
- return $persister->exists($element, array($mapping['mappedBy'] => $id));
- }
- /**
- * @param \Doctrine\ORM\PersistentCollection $coll
- * @param object $element
- *
- * @return boolean
- */
- public function removeElement(PersistentCollection $coll, $element)
- {
- $mapping = $coll->getMapping();
- if ( ! $mapping['orphanRemoval']) {
- // no-op: this is not the owning side, therefore no operations should be applied
- return false;
- }
- $uow = $this->em->getUnitOfWork();
- // shortcut for new entities
- $entityState = $uow->getEntityState($element, UnitOfWork::STATE_NEW);
- if ($entityState === UnitOfWork::STATE_NEW) {
- return false;
- }
- // If Entity is scheduled for inclusion, it is not in this collection.
- // We can assure that because it would have return true before on array check
- if ($entityState === UnitOfWork::STATE_MANAGED && $uow->isScheduledForInsert($element)) {
- return false;
- }
- $this
- ->uow
- ->getEntityPersister($mapping['targetEntity'])
- ->delete($element);
- return true;
- }
- }
